I know this is an old thread but I have been struggling with this since I upgraded a few days ago and I think I've found a solution;
1. Right click my computer and go to properties (or control panel > system and security > system)
2. On the left, go into system protection.
3. If protection on the C: drive is on go into properties and disable it.
I am now able to alter files in the C: drive.
